WebMar 13, 2024 · The process is easy: Add the scores of all the people who took the test. Divide that total by the number of people. Suppose 10 people take a test that has a maximum score of 100. Their scores are 55, 66, 72, 61, 83, 58, 85, 75, 79 and 67. The total of these scores is 701.
